+7 913 985 69 71 Envelop 5927e2bc4f7195a77dda21f7859ed9d3bf9c3c724f49439b85f191cfc618519c info@megatrader.org
ru
Арбитраж бинарных опционов

подробнее
MegaClicker имитатор ручной торговли для
MT4
подробнее
Бесплатный вебинар

подробнее

Одноногий арбитраж на форекс: MegaTrader в связке с SaxoTrader

Если исследовать причины возникновения арбитражных ситуаций на форексе, то можно обнаружить, что в абсолютном большинстве случаев они связаны с отставанием котировок одного дилера относительно другого. Причины отставания котировок могут быть различны: это и долгий путь котировок от поставщика ликвидности через сервер дилера к терминалам рядовых трейдеров, и различные преобразования потока котировок на стороне дилера как-то: фильтрация, сглаживание и т.д. В результате, в моменты резких движений цен возникает естественное отставание тех котировок, которые трейдеры видят в своих терминалах, от реальных котировок, которые дают поставщики ликвидности. Если в такие моменты разрыв цен будет достаточно большим, чтобы покрыть издержки (спред, комиссию), то можно открыть сделку на стороне отстающего дилера в сторону реальной котировки, которую в этот момент можно наблюдать у другого, более быстрого дилера. В этом случае мы будем иметь постоянное статистическое преимущество, реализуя которое, можно добиться стабильного роста прибыли.

Важно отметить, что при реализации данной стратегии нет никакой необходимости хеджировать открытую позицию на стороне второго дилера, как это бывает при классическом арбитраже. Дело в том, что, во-первых, прибыль все равно всегда будет накапливаться на стороне отстающего дилера, а во-вторых, при хеджировании, будут возникать дополнительные издержки в виде спреда и комиссии на стороне второго дилера. Такой вид арбитража, без хеджирования, называется одноногим арбитражем.

Таким образом, для успешного арбитража на форексе необходимо иметь источник опережающих котировок. Для этого можно использовать другого дилера с более быстрыми котировками, как это было описано в статье «арбитраж на форекс». Но есть более надежный вариант – использовать котировки какого-нибудь крупного банка или брокера. В частности, нами было достоверно установлено, что поток котировок известного европейского банка и брокера Saxo bank (http://www.saxobank.com), поставляемый через их собственный терминал SaxoTrader, в моменты резких движений цен опережает котировки большинства дилеров, использующих терминал MetaTrader. Поэтому в версии 1.2 программы Megatrader мы реализовали возможность получать котировки из терминала SaxoTrader 2.

Рассмотрим, каким образом реализовать одноногий арбитраж на форекс, используя программу Megatrader в связке с терминалом SaxoTrader.

Для начала скачиваем и устанавливаем терминал SaxoTrader 2 с официального сайта http://www.saxobank.com (http://ru.saxobank.com – русскоязычная версия сайта). При установке терминала обязательно укажите язык интерфейса программы – английский (язык можно сменить и после установки программы – в настройках платформы).

Далее, на том же сайте откройте демо-счет. Демо-счет предоставляется на 20 дней, однако его можно переоткрывать неограниченное количество раз. Если же Вы не желаете постоянно открывать новые демо-счета – есть смысл открыть реальный счет.

Терминал SaxoTrader не поддерживает экспорт котировок напрямую, поэтому мы были вынуждены разработать специальный вспомогательный модуль SaxoExporter, который «читает» котировки непосредственно из оконных интерфейсов терминала, а точнее – из окошек «Trade Tickets». Таким образом, чтобы экспортировать котировки из терминала SaxoTrader, необходимо открыть окна «Trade Tickets» для всех инструментов, которые Вы хотите экспортировать:

Кроме того, для корректного чтения котировок необходимо в настройках терминала SaxoTrader установить английский язык (English) и региональные настройки (English (United Kingdom)), как показано на рисунке ниже:

Теперь перейдем к настройкам программы Megatrader. Здесь все просто. Достаточно при добавлении нового инструмент указать терминал – «SaxoTrader», а в настройках инструмента, в параметре «Код инструмента», указать его обозначение в терминале SaxoTrader (к примеру, для пары EUR/USD пишем просто «EURUSD»):

Чтобы начать экспорт котировок из SaxoTrader в программу Megatrader достаточно в программе Megatrader выполнить команду меню «Связь» – «Установить соединение с SaxoTrader», после чего котировки начнут поступать в программу. Еще раз обратим внимание, что экспортироваться будут котировки только тех инструментов, для которых в терминале SaxoTrader открыты окошки «Trade Tickets».

При выполнении команды «Установить соединение с SaxoTrader», программа Megatrader автоматически запустит модуль SaxoExporter, осуществляющий экспорт котировок из SaxoTrader в Megatrader. Иконка запущенного модуля появиться внизу экрана в трее:

Интерфейс модуля содержит всего две кнопки: «Запустить» и «Остановить», которые соответственно запускают и останавливают процесс экспорта:

Если уже после запуска экспорта в терминале SaxoTrader будет добавлено новое окошко «Trade Tickets», то для того, чтобы модуль SaxoExporter «увидел» его, необходимо перезапустить экспорт (нажать кнопку «Остановить», а затем «Запустить»).

Ниже приведен типичный пример графика спреда при арбитраже с использованием SaxoTrader. На графике специально выделены места возникновения арбитражных ситуаций:

Количество арбитражных ситуаций у разных дилеров может варьироваться в широких пределах: от нескольких десятков в один день до одной - двух в месяц. Все зависит от степени отставания потока котировок дилера от реальных цен.

В заключение опровергнем бытующее в Интернете устойчивое мнение, что заниматься арбитражем на форексе не имеет смысла, поскольку дилер все равно не отдаст заработанную прибыль. Это заблуждение в первую очередь связано с тем, что предлагающиеся на рынке арбитражные советники совершают сверхкороткие сделки, которые всегда становятся предметом пристального внимания дилеров. Более того, в настоящее время практически у всех дилеров в регламенте предоставления услуг прописано минимальное время удержания сделки, которое обычно составляет не менее 1-3 минут, и дилер имеет полное право отменить сделки, не удовлетворяющие их регламенту. Однако арбитражные сделки совсем не обязательно должны быть коротким, и если увеличить длительность сделок, то у дилеров, как правило, перестают возникать претензии к торговле. По нашему личному опыту, если удерживать позиции не менее 10 минут, то проблем с выводом заработанной прибыли возникать не будет.

Объясним, почему даже после увеличения времени удержания позиции, арбитражная торговля все равно останется прибыльной. Дело в том, что, открывая сделку в момент задержки котировок, мы всегда получаем небольшое преимущество. Куда цена пойдет дальше, после того, как ценовой разрыв будет устранен, мы не знаем, но при большом количестве сделок можно считать, что в половине случаев дальнейшее движение цены принесет нам прибыль, а в другой половине – убыток. Таким образом, при большом количестве сделок, прибыли и убытки от движения цены после устранения разрыва будут компенсировать друг друга, и в сухом остатке мы получим то самое небольшое преимущество, которое и обеспечит стабильный рост прибыли. Таким образом, увеличение длительности удержания позиции, по сути, приведет к увеличению дисперсии графика доходности (которая отразится в виде увеличения просадки счета, что надо обязательно учитывать при выборе размера лота), а средняя прибыльность сделки останется неизменной. Однако надо помнить, что эти рассуждения справедливы только для большого количества сделок, когда начинает работать закон больших чисел.

Таким образом, арбитраж на форексе все еще остается актуальной и высокодоходной инвестиционной стратегией. Примеры реальной арбитражной торговли с выводом прибыли можно посмотреть в разделе Видеоотчеты.

Замечание. В настоящее время программа Megatrader, помимо SaxoTrader, поддерживает и другие, более быстрые источники опережающих котировок: CQG, Rithmic, LMAX и Integral. Список источников постоянно расширяется, поэтому рекомендуем следить за обновлениями.